What was the most challenging aspect of developing mobile app?

Connected, is the most difficult part of the "connected health" thing. Healthcare is complex and expensive enough for parties involved to not be easily susceptible to rapid change or particularly adventurous in forging new partnerships. From the start, MedM wanted to make software that would work if not with most, then with ALL possible medical sensors. And this proved to be the most challenging part. This goal was complex enough in engineering, but the business side of things was even more difficult. Today, MedM apps work with nearly 600 mobile medical devices. We have built a solution that collects data from peripheral sensors automatically, using the Bluetooth communication protocol. And we invest heavily into building lasting relationships with OEMs and ODMs making medical devices for the mass market.

How long have you been working on this app?

It took us only about 3 months to actually build the MedM Blood Pressure app (and we built it on the basis of MedM Health), but it took over 5 years to make it the app it is today. By experience, from 80 to 90% of an app's lifecycle is actually support. We cherish our users wishes and preferences, we constantly keep working on making the app better.

What need of the user did you have in mind when developing this app?

These are the concepts we had in mind when making this app: Save time for our users, make it possible to log medical data efficiently and accurately, preferably automatically. We also wanted to give people the freedom and decide if they want to not create a user account and opt for storing all their data offline, directly on the smartphone. Our users are also free to choose manual data entry, bypassing the automatic data collection model all together. And last, but not least, we wanted to make it possible for people to share their health data effortlessly, with the people they trust: family and healthcare professionals.

This app is the absolute world leader in the number of connected Bluetooth monitors and it is essential for those who need to keep track of blood pressure on a regular basis. MedM BP offers easy pairing, reliable data transfer to offline or in-cloud storage, can be used with or without registration by multiple users, supports thresholds, export to Google Fit, manual data entry from legacy meters, and provides trend analysis tools.

MedM BP has a clean interface and is designed in accordance with the established medical guidelines. Robust historical and trend analysis tools empower users to discover patterns and adjust behavior accordingly. Thresholds make it possible for users and their loved ones to receive notifications (push or email) if a reading surpasses the set value.

Optional integration with MedM Health Cloud is available to registered users and makes it possible to not only store, backup, and export blood pressure history securely and reliably, but also to share it with family, caregivers, and physicians.
